Columbia's current population is 40,671 people with 16,051 households within this smaller 2 mile radius. This area experienced positive population growth of 9.0% from 2010-2020. This area is projected to grow another 2.1% over the next five years. This is higher than the national average.
The median age of the population in this area is 24.1 which is well below the state average of 39.5 years old. This area has an average household size of 1.97 persons. This area is not very family centric with 34.0% of the households being family households and with 18.2% having children in the home and 10.3% of the population being under 15 and an additional 44.5% being under 24. Another 22.9% of this area’s population is between 25 and 44 years of age and 12.6% between 45-64 years old leaving 9.8% of the population over 65 years old. These last two age groups are target age groups for dentures, partials, crowns, and other restorative work. This area does have a higher percentage of the population between 15-24 years old which could indicate a college population in this area. Many college students are included in the count, but do not typically make the best patient base for the area.
Columbia has a daytime employee population of 64,199 versus a permanent population of 40,671 meaning the daytime employee population is 157.8% of the permanent population living in the area and 76.0% of the total daytime population. Columbia has a significant employee population that strongly influences the area. This could allow a practice to keep more daytime weekday hours as opposed to early morning hours, evening hours, or Saturday hours.
| |
In this area, 55.3% of the population either holds a bachelor's degree or higher educational degree. Columbia is higher than the state and US average.
The dominant racial and ethnic groups of the population in the Columbia area are White 72.2%, Black 12.5%, Asian 5.6%, 2.3% other races and 5.1% Hispanic or Latino of any race.
